In which disorder does a person seem to experience at least two or more distinct personalities existing in one body?\

dissociative identity disorder (DID
Previously known as multiple personality disorder, dissociative identity disorder (DID) is a condition in which a person has more than one distinct identity or personality state. At least two of these personalities repeatedly assert themselves to control the affected person's behavior.
